Share of men expected to survive to the age of 65 in Malawi
Malawi: Share of men expected to survive to the age of 65 was 60.0% in 2024. ▲ Rising
Share of men expected to survive to the age of 65 in Malawi, 1960–2024
Source: United Nations Population Division (World Population Prospects), via World Bank (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in % of cohort.
Analysis
In 2024, share of men expected to survive to the age of 65 in Malawi stood at 60.0%. That is the highest value across all 65 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.6% on the previous year and up 22.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of men expected to survive to the age of 65 in Malawi peaked at 60.0%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 25.6%, in 1960.
That places Malawi 183rd out of 215 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 65 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 26.2% | 25.6% | 26.6% | 10 |
| 1970s | 30.3% | 26.9% | 34.1% | 10 |
| 1980s | 34.0% | 31.8% | 35.2% | 10 |
| 1990s | 29.2% | 26.9% | 31.6% | 10 |
| 2000s | 35.2% | 28.7% | 42.7% | 10 |
| 2010s | 49.4% | 44.0% | 53.8% | 10 |
| 2020s | 56.4% | 52.5% | 60.0% | 5 |

About this data
This measure shows the share newborns that would survive to the age of 65, if subject to age-specific death rates in a given year.
